Raid The Quarry released their music video for “S.O.S” featuring Logan Christopher. S.O.S is their first single off their upcoming album “Beyond These Castle Walls”, which comes out December 9th! The video takes place at a haunted house to help drive home the feeling of hopelessness, isolation, and depression that people can feel. However, as they put it, the song “…is a lantern in the night that declares you are loved and you are valuable.” You can check out their post about that here. Les Carlsen of BLOODGOOD released his first solo album called “He’s Coming”. You can buy the physical copy here! While on the subject of this awesome new album, Les Carlsen gave a shout out to The Protest and D.C Talk on one of his songs off the album called “The Jesus Freak Show”.
